Kurt Roach (Sydney, NS) finished 0-4 in the 15-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Roach lost 5-1 to Paul Dexter (Halifax, NS), droppimg another game, 7-1 to Robert Mayhew (Halifax, NS). Roach lost 7-4 to Shawn Adams (Halifax, NS). Roach lost 6-1 to Matthew Manuel (Halifax, NS) in their final qualifying round match.
